Simulation of suitable habitats for typical vegetation in the Yellow River Estuary based on complex hydrodynamic processes
Estuarine ecosystems are influenced by the combination of freshwater runoff and ocean tides, and the natural environment is intricate and complex, with special natural environmental conditions and biological habitat characteristics.
